Interested in developing solutions that extend the office experience across multiple platforms. We had a shared excel workbook with some simple macros nothing complicated. Excel visual basic for applications vba reference microsoft docs. To edit a macro, in the developer tab, click macros, select the name of the macro, and click edit. Using excel, record a macro that enters your name in the current cell and formats it as italic. Macros are recorded in the visual basic for applications programming language. Pressing f8 will let you step through the macro code one line at.
Default to visual basic instead of macros microsoft. Buy beginning excel vba programming microsoft store. Download this app from microsoft store for windows 10, windows 8. The microsoft download manager solves these potential problems.
Download office 20 vba documentation from official microsoft. This reference is for experienced office users who want to learn about vba and who want some insight into how programming can help them to. Options add a shortcut key, or a macro description. We had a shared excel workbook with some simple macro s nothing complicated.
Development tools downloads microsoft visual basic by microsoft and many more programs are available for instant and free download. Conceptual overviews, programming tasks, samples, and references to guide you in developing solutions based on visual basic for. Then, share your extension with the community in the visual studio. Describes how to customize the visual basic editor, and provides documentation for the object model that enables you to extend the environment. Sep 27, 20 the office 20 vba documentation download provides an offline version of the visual basic for applications vba developer reference for each of the office client applications, as well as the vba reference content shared amongst all office client applications office shared. In the macro name box, click the macro that you want to run, and press the run button. Microsoft provides programming examples for illustration only, without warranty either expressed or implied, including, but not limited to, the implied warranties of merchantability andor fitness for a particular purpose. To start automating your excel actions with macros, youll need to record a macro. Microsoft visual basic the macros in this project are. And while you can code a macro using visual basic for applications vba, excel also lets you record a macro by using standard commands. You can control outlook by writing a macro in visual basic for applications, a custom form in vbscript, and other languages that you can use to. Take a closer look at the macro you can learn a little about the visual basic programming language by editing a macro. Provides reference materials for the excel object model.
Start studying excel using macros and visual basic for applications. To open the visual basic editor, on the developer tab, click visual basic. In the first video, we saw how to record a macro, and how and why to turn on use relative references, so the macro behaves the way. Excel is composed of rows and columns and uses a spreadsheet to display data. The office 20 vba documentation download provides an offline version of the visual basic for applications vba developer reference for. T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. Access macro actions represent only a subset of the commands available in vba. Summarizes the way that keywords, placeholders, and other elements of the language are formatted in the visual basic documentation. Download readiness toolkit for office addins and vba. Conceptual overviews, programming tasks, samples, and references to help you develop excel solutions. Word office client development support and feedback. See how the actions that you recorded appear as code. Run your hello macro using a button on the quick access toolbar.
A macro is an action or a set of actions that you can use to automate tasks. This section provides reference information for various aspects of the visual basic language. Office for mac for visual basic for applications vba. Aug 08, 2006 download directx enduser runtime web installer. How to create visual basic for applications vba in excel with. Visual studio 2019 ide programming software for windows.
The ms excel visual basic for applications macros course aims to impar. Migrating your macros lets you take advantage of the improvements to the vba programming object model. Provides reference materials for the visio object model. Vba stands for visual basic for applications, in this tutorial we learn with examples to create excel macro like hello world, simple emi. Net gadgeteer is a really easytouse platform for creating new electronic devices using a wide variety of hardware modules and a powerful programming environment. Microsoft windows macros and visual basic signing user guide document issue. In the macro name box, click the macro that you want to edit. If you decide youre not ready to migrate, you can still run excel 4. An identified security issue in microsoft visual basic for applications could allow an attacker to compromise a microsoft windowsbased system and then take a variety of actions. Create and save all your macros in a single workbook. Another button on the developer tab in word and excel is the record macro button, which automatically generates vba code that can reproduce the actions that you perform in the application.
As with any modern programming language, visual basic supports many common programming constructs and language elements. How to create and run a basic macro in all versions of excel. This software is available to download from the publisher site. At its core, excel is a table consisting of rows and columns. It also allows you to suspend active downloads and resume downloads that have failed. The excel visual basic editor is also sometimes referred to as the vba project window. Microsoft visual basic free download windows version. The visual studio for mac debugger lets you step inside your code by setting breakpoints, step over statements, step into and out of functions, and inspect the current state of the code stack through powerful visualizations.
Excel office client development support and feedback. Please see office vba support and feedback for guidance about the ways you can receive. Visio office client development support and feedback. Visual basic a macro is a sequence of instructions that can be automatically executed in order to automate frequent or complicated tasks. It assumes no prior knowledge of programming, electronics, visual basic or the visual studio environment. After the update ones the workbook is opened by someone and changes are made and saved i got microsoft visual basic for applications. With visual micro you are building on top of the arduino system, maintaining compatability with all ino pde files, and the. This reference contains conceptual overviews, programming tasks, samples, and references to guide you in developing solutions based on vba. To enable macro repeat play a macro repeatedly in the macro editor, select a macro from the available macros. Language reference for visual basic for applications vba.
Record macro is a terrific tool that you can use to learn more. How to dynamically add and run a vba macro from visual basic. By installing this update, you can help protect your computer. In visual basic for applications procedures, the words after the apostrophe are comments. The developer tab, on the ribbon, is where all of the macro commands are. Powerpoint visual basic for applications vba reference microsoft docs skip to main content. To make a macro from one document available in all new documents, add. There are several ways to run a macro in microsoft excel. The vba project the visual basic editor stores customizations in a project file.
In excel 2003 and in earlier versions of excel, point to macro on the tools menu, and then click security. It also provides information about where to get help understanding each issue and the types of skills needed to address them. Microsoft visual basic runtime error type mismatch in. Use the visual studio debugger to quickly find and fix bugs across languages. Default to visual basic instead of macros i would like to be able to have access default to creating visual basic entries instead of macros upon placing controls i.
To run a macro, click the button on the quick access toolbar, press the keyboard shortcut, or you can run the macro from the macros list. Have questions or feedback about office vba or this documentation. Visual basic manual software free download visual basic. The visual basic button opens the visual basic editor, where you create and edit vba code. Microsoft visual basic the macros in this project are disabled when i pull up word i have a mini hp 110 with windows xp. In the security dialog box, click the trusted sources tab, and then click to select the trust access to visual basic project check box.
It gives you the ability to download multiple files at one time and download large files quickly and reliably. Download microsoft visual basic for applications update. Conceptual overviews, programming tasks, samples, and references to help you develop powerpoint solutions. Visual basic editor tutorial for excel how to use the. You can always run a macro by clicking the macros command on the developer tab on the ribbon. Microsoft windows macros and visual basic signing user guide. Visual basic is the programming language that macros are recorded in. In the list under macro name, click the macro you want to run.
Excel using macros and visual basic for applications. It allows you to code simple visual basic for applications macros. Apr 17, 2018 this article demonstrates how to dynamically add a vba module to a running office application from visual basic, and then call the macro to fill a worksheet inprocess. Back next the office 20 vba documentation download provides an offline version of the visual basic for applications vba developer reference for each of the office client applications, as well as the vba reference content shared amongst all office client applications office. Save 16% off office 365 with a yearly subscription. For information about vba for excel, powerpoint, and word, see the following. Microsoft excel visual basic for applications macros. To edit a macro, in the code group on the developer tab, click macros, select the name of the macro, and click edit. Macros are written in a programming language called visual basic and can be created by recording a task or by writing the visual basic program or. Create addons and extensions for visual studio, including new commands, code analyzers, and tool windows. Office visual basic for applications vba reference microsoft docs. Welcome to the visual basic for applications vba language reference for office. This guide describes all the major elements of programming with visual basic.
Please see office vba support and feedback for guidance about the ways you can receive support and provide feedback. Click the command button on the sheet make sure design mode is deselected. The visual basic editor vbe is a simple developer environment available in excel, access, powerpoint, word and all other ms office applications. The other equinox academy modules that need to have been covered prior to subscribing for this training. Microsoft excel is a spreadsheet application that is commonly used for a variety of uses. This book is intended for school students and others learning to program in visual basic. With visual micro you are guided to use the normal arduino framework, similar to the arduino ide, with menus and buttons simplifying board selection, library and code additions and debugging.
Microsoft download manager is free and available for download now. Programming concepts are introduced and explained throughout the book. The visual basic editor is similar for each host application, so if youve used vba with microsoft excel or word, the visual basic editor in microsoft dynamics gp will be familiar. Contains documentation on the basic structure and code conventions of visual basic, such as naming conventions, comments in code, and limitations. Visual basic for applicationsrecording macros wikiversity. Microsoft visual basic 2015 for windows, web, corinne hoisington. You should remember that in access help articles, access macros are referred to as macros. Macros are written in a programming language called visual basic and can be created by recording a task or by writing the visual basic program or by a combination of the two. Vbscript reference manual indusoft web studio 8 indusoft, ltd. Use this tool to inspect vba macro code and get readiness information for.
Get latest updates to the microsoft visual studio development system. We plan to discuss basic concepts of vbamacro such as hierarchical microsoft office object model and the difference between macro and vba. Run your hello macro using a button in a custom tab or custom group on the ribbon. Office addins have a small footprint compared to vsto addins and solutions. Provides documentation about visual basic the language. Jun 09, 2019 microsoft support engineers can help explain the functionality of a particular procedure, but they will not modify these examples to provide added functionality or construct procedures to meet your specific requirements. Microsoft excel vba programming for dummies 2nd edition book. It was extremely popular, and is still used in many businesses. Powerpoint office client development support and feedback. User interface help describes user interface elements of the visual basic editor, such as menus and commands, dialog boxes, windows, and toolbars.
It is the last that can create native 32bit applications for windows 9x and nt. Visualbasic namespace, with links to their member functions, methods. Step this will open the visual basic editor to the first line of the macro. Click in editor and edit the macro or enter new events. Learn vocabulary, terms, and more with flashcards, games, and other study tools.
You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. Provides reference materials for the powerpoint object model. If you are authoring macros for office for mac, you can use most of the same objects that are available in vba for office. Visual basic for applicationsediting macros wikiversity. Net, vba and vbscript the evolution most everyone is familiar with basic, the beginners allpurpose symbolic instruction code that has been around since 1964. Visual basic macro examples for working with arrays. Net gadgeteer foreword computer programming can be fun. I have an older version of word that has been working fine, up until late, when i go to open a word doc. Powerpoint visual basic for applications vba reference. Pdf microsoft visual basic for applications vbamacro. Microsoft visual basic visual studio is extensible by nature, ultimately consisting of a core shell that implements all commands, windows, editors, project types, languages, and other features through dynamically loadable modules called packages. Name the macro something similar to entermyname and assign it to any key you wish. May 31, 2012 download manual guide of visual basic programming guide 2010 in pdf that we listed in manual guide. This tool analyzes the application components and the relationships between them from an upgrade perspective, considering elements, constructs, and features that consume resources during an upgrade.
Nov 26, 2018 welcome to the visual basic for applications vba language reference for office. More information the following sample demonstrates inserting a code module into microsoft excel, but you can use the same technique for word and powerpoint because both. Kb923167, microsoft visual basic for applications update q822150, microsoft. Error message when you run a visual basic for applications. Visual basic editor tutorial for excel how to use the vbe. Download microsoft dynamics gp 20 tools documentation. Watch this video to see how to edit a macro in a special text editor called the visual basic editor. Click the button assigned to the macro again, or start another macro. Aimed at high school students and firsttime programmers, the authors use a combination of hardware and software to make programming come alive audibly, visually, and tangibly. Download microsoft visual basic 2010 for free windows. The macro builder gives you a more structured interface than the visual basic editor, enabling you to add programming to controls and objects without having to learn vba code. Provides reference materials for the word object model. Object library reference for office members, properties, methods office client development reference.
324 204 1433 614 1341 910 519 1605 1368 1095 1517 420 1327 174 1212 133 364 509 710 1349 256 460 1448 366 1252 779 769 1490 1097 472 1051